What's Ailing the NHS?

Current affairs programme, including reports on difficulties facing the NHS, and the cost of aircraft to the British Army, with the F111 fighter plane coming under particular scrutiny. (1967)

Did You Know?

When he was a young registrar, Professor Miller was known as Henry 'Gorgeous' Miller, and was notable for his elegant attire. Anthony Trafford later became Minister of Health during the Thatcher administration.
